I am 79 years old, and recent illness, age, and inactivity had slowed me nearly to a stop. I attempted to walk and barely made it a quarter-mile. My cardiologist suggested I speak with Parker Condit. Now, after 30 sessions, I am happy to say I can hike 5 miles! Parker’s approach includes aerobics, resistance, and weight training—all bolstered with incredible knowledge, patience, and positive reinforcement. In addition to the physical improvements, I have benefited from improved sleep, freedom from pain and stiffness, and a regained sense of confidence. I am hard to please, so recommending Parker 100% without reservation is something I do not take lightly. If you desire a professional and rewarding experience, Parker is the guy to see!
– Dennis M
As a healthcare provider and personal trainer, my practice is dedicated to bridging the gap between physical fitness and cognitive longevity. I specialize in working with adults who want to actively protect their short-term memory, stay sharp in conversations, and maintain the physical independence needed to enjoy retirement on their own terms. Having spent a significant portion of my career optimizing peak physical performance and mental resilience for elite, professional athletes, I now apply that same precise, evidence-based focus to helping individuals protect their balance, mental clarity, and daily confidence as they age.
True cognitive protection requires looking at the human body as a single, integrated system. My training approach blends:
Dual task training simultaneously combines physical movement with cognitive challenges to systematically build new neural pathways. By actively collaborating with a network of local medical specialists, including neurologists and occupational therapists, I ensure your lifestyle care is completely aligned with your clinical team. Whether you're noticing the early signs of changes in your balance, managing a formal clinical recommendation, or simply wanting to aggressively safeguard your long-term cognitive vitality, we work together to attain outcomes that ensure you can continue to live, move, and thrive on your own terms.Â
